Recognizing Xeriscaping

Xeriscaping is a landscaping strategy that originated in deserts and has actually gotten popularity in water-conscious neighborhoods like Ft Collins. The term "xeriscape" is originated from the Greek word "xeros," meaning dry, and "scape," describing a sight or scene. At its core, xeriscaping objectives to develop visually attractive landscapes that call for marginal water, fertilizer, and maintenance.

Concepts of Xeriscaping

1. Water Preservation: Xeriscaping focuses on decreasing water use by picking drought-tolerant plants, improving soil high quality, and applying efficient irrigation techniques.

2. Drought Resistance: Xeriscape yards are designed to flourish in dry problems, with a focus on choose plants adjusted to the regional environment and dirt problems.

3. Dirt Improvement: Healthy soil is vital for water retention and plant growth in xeriscape landscapes. Integrating raw material and compost assists enhance soil structure and wetness retention.

4. Proper Plant Choice: Xeriscape gardens feature a diverse selection of plants that are well-suited to the local environment and call for marginal watering when established.

5. Efficient Irrigation: Xeriscape yards make use of water-efficient watering systems, such as drip irrigation or soaker hose pipes, to deliver water straight to the origin zone of plants, reducing evaporation and runoff.

Creating a Xeriscape Garden

Evaluating Your Landscape

Before starting a xeriscape job, analyze your landscape to determine variables such as sunshine exposure, dirt kind, and existing greenery. Understanding these problems will aid you choose suitable plants and layout aspects for your xeriscape garden.

Picking Drought-Tolerant Plants

Choosing the right plants is essential for an effective xeriscape garden. Choose indigenous and drought-tolerant species that are adjusted to the climate and dirt conditions of Ft Collins. Consider variables such as water demands, fully grown size, and seasonal passion when choosing plants for your xeriscape yard.

Incorporating Hardscape Components

Hardscape elements, such as paths, patios, and maintaining walls, play a crucial role in xeriscape style. Pick resilient and water-efficient products, such as gravel, rock, and specialty rock, to create aesthetically appealing hardscape functions that enhance the natural appeal of your xeriscape yard.

Executing Effective Watering

Efficient irrigation is necessary for water preservation in xeriscape gardens. Think about mounting a drip watering system or soaker hoses to deliver water directly to the root area of plants, lessening evaporation and overflow. Compost can additionally aid retain wetness in the soil and minimize the demand for constant watering.
